MySQL 添加索引和列的步骤
作为一名经验丰富的开发者,我可以帮助你学习如何在 MySQL 数据库中添加索引和列。在本篇文章中,我将按照以下步骤详细介绍整个流程,并提供每一步所需的代码及其注释。
步骤概览
以下表格展示了添加索引和列的步骤概览:
步骤 | 操作 |
---|---|
步骤 1 | 连接到 MySQL 数据库 |
步骤 2 | 创建索引 |
步骤 3 | 修改表结构 |
步骤 4 | 添加新的列 |
现在让我们逐步进行每个步骤的操作。
步骤 1:连接到 MySQL 数据库
使用以下代码连接到 MySQL 数据库:
mysql -u username -p
username
是你的数据库用户名。
这将要求你输入密码以完成连接。
步骤 2:创建索引
使用以下代码创建索引:
CREATE INDEX index_name ON table_name (column_name);
index_name
是要创建的索引的名称。table_name
是要添加索引的表的名称。column_name
是要添加索引的列的名称。
请确保在创建索引之前,你已经对数据库进行了充分的规划,并确定了需要添加索引的列。
步骤 3:修改表结构
使用以下代码修改表结构:
ALTER TABLE table_name MODIFY COLUMN column_name new_data_type;
table_name
是要修改结构的表的名称。column_name
是要修改的列的名称。new_data_type
是列的新数据类型。
此步骤用于修改表中已有列的数据类型。请确保在修改表结构之前备份数据,以防止意外数据丢失。
步骤 4:添加新的列
使用以下代码添加新的列:
ALTER TABLE table_name ADD COLUMN column_name data_type;
table_name
是要添加列的表的名称。column_name
是要添加的列的名称。data_type
是新列的数据类型。
通过执行此代码,你可以向表中添加新的列。请确保在添加新的列之前备份数据,以防止意外数据丢失。
以上就是添加索引和列的完整步骤。你可以根据自己的需求和具体情况调整每个步骤中的代码。希望这篇文章对你有所帮助!